Overview

Support the Girls follows Lisa, the manager of a Hooters-style highway sports bar, through one particularly brutal day of holding her staff together against a tide of small disasters. The film earns its Leans Progressive label through its sympathetic lens on low-wage women doing emotional labor in an openly objectifying workplace. Female solidarity functions as the real safety net here, replacing both traditional family structures and institutional support. Lisa's marriage is fraying, no religious framework appears, and the women lean on each other in ways the workplace and the economy clearly never will. The politics are felt rather than stated, which keeps the film grounded rather than preachy.

Detailed Bias Analysis

Analyzing...
Leans Progressive

Primary

Political: Leans Left
Confidence: High

The film is left-leaning due to its empathetic portrayal of low-wage female workers facing systemic exploitation and economic precarity, highlighting their struggles and the importance of mutual support within an objectifying workplace.

Diversity: Moderate
Confidence: Medium

The movie features a visibly diverse cast, including a Black lead actress, in roles that are not traditionally defined by race. The narrative explores themes of female solidarity and economic challenges within a service industry setting, without explicitly critiquing traditional identities or centering on a strong DEI agenda.

Secondary

Family Values: Leans Progressive
Confidence: Medium

The film portrays a chosen family among co-workers as the primary source of support, while depicting the breakdown of a traditional marriage and the absence of traditional gender roles or religious family life. It normalizes alternative family arrangements and relationships outside of traditional norms.
